Stockwell’s Chill n Grill Store locator Washington

Stockwell’s Chill n Grill stores located in Washington: 1

Stockwell’s Chill n Grill store locator Washington displays complete list and huge database of Stockwell’s Chill n Grill stores, factory stores, shops and boutiques in Washington. Stockwell’s Chill n Grill information: map of Washington, shopping hours, contact information.

Search all Stockwell’s Chill n Grill stores located in Washington

Specify Stockwell’s Chill n Grill store location:

Go to the city Stockwell’s Chill n Grill locator